最新iOS 应用发布到AppStore详细流程(第二篇)

上一篇文章主要是介绍了ios应用发布AppStore所需要的准备工作和配置Xcode打包上传的流程,本文对上一篇进行补充,主要内容是:配置推送证书。这是上一篇的地址《最新iOS 应用发布到AppStore详细流程》。

配置推送证书

上一篇配置的证书没有推送功能,所以补充一下,分为以下几个步骤:创建秘钥、配置App ID、利用App ID创建推送证书

  • 1.创建秘钥,在其他中找到钥匙串访问
最新iOS 应用发布到AppStore详细流程(第二篇)_第1张图片
屏幕快照 2016-12-28 下午4.29.19
  • 2.打开钥匙串访问,点击电脑左上角的钥匙串访问–证书助理–从证书颁发机构请求证书
屏幕快照2016-12-28 下午4.30.51
  • 3.会出现如下界面,选择存储到磁盘,点击继续
最新iOS 应用发布到AppStore详细流程(第二篇)_第2张图片
屏幕快照 2016-12-28 下午4.32.19
  • 4.选择存储到桌面
最新iOS 应用发布到AppStore详细流程(第二篇)_第3张图片
屏幕快照 2016-12-28 下午4.32.54
最新iOS 应用发布到AppStore详细流程(第二篇)_第4张图片
创建后的文件
  • 5.登录苹果开发者网站,假设已经创建好了App ID,但还没开通推送功能,点击此App ID会出现详细信息
最新iOS 应用发布到AppStore详细流程(第二篇)_第5张图片
屏幕快照 2017-01-18 下午2.41.11.png
  • 6.点击Edit,勾选Push Notification选项,点击Creat Certificate,上面的是开发时使用,下面是发布时使用,根据自己的需要。
最新iOS 应用发布到AppStore详细流程(第二篇)_第6张图片
屏幕快照 2017-01-18 下午2.41.44.png
  • 7.点击Continue


    最新iOS 应用发布到AppStore详细流程(第二篇)_第7张图片
    屏幕快照 2017-01-18 下午2.42.24.png
  • 8.点击Choose File,选择刚刚创建的CertificateSigningRequest文件,然后点击Continue


    最新iOS 应用发布到AppStore详细流程(第二篇)_第8张图片
    屏幕快照 2017-01-18 下午2.42.41.png
  • 9.点击download,双击此文件,然后点Done
最新iOS 应用发布到AppStore详细流程(第二篇)_第9张图片
屏幕快照 2017-01-18 下午2.43.06.png
  • 10.这时此App ID的详细信息 的Push Notification功能显示Enabled
最新iOS 应用发布到AppStore详细流程(第二篇)_第10张图片
屏幕快照 2017-01-18 下午2.46.35.png
  • 11.假设已经创建了对应此App ID的配置文件,由于改动App ID此文件应该会显示Invalid
最新iOS 应用发布到AppStore详细流程(第二篇)_第11张图片
屏幕快照 2017-01-18 下午2.47.43.png
  • 12.点击Edit后,检查信息是否正确,点击Generate。
最新iOS 应用发布到AppStore详细流程(第二篇)_第12张图片
屏幕快照 2017-01-18 下午2.49.52.png
  • 13.点击Download后点击Done,然后双击此文件导入Xcode
最新iOS 应用发布到AppStore详细流程(第二篇)_第13张图片
屏幕快照 2017-01-18 下午2.50.05.png
  • 14.最后别忘了在Xcode工程中打开Push Notification开关
最新iOS 应用发布到AppStore详细流程(第二篇)_第14张图片
屏幕快照 2017-01-18 下午3.54.34.png

这样打包后发布的程序就具备推送功能了,我会在后续的文章中介绍上传的第二种方式(Application Loader)及上传过程中常遇到的坑。请大家关注我的动态,谢谢大家的支持,祝各位好运!

你可能感兴趣的:(最新iOS 应用发布到AppStore详细流程(第二篇))